Escape the Cape: We had many, many improvements for the 2017 edition of this award-winning triathlon. BUT, if there is something we can get better at it is our swim course design. We had quite a few athletes get swept around the rocks as they approached the swim finish by the West End Jetty. This is not acceptable for us. To remedy this in 2018, we are going to push the swim finish up the beach to finish at Lincoln Blvd. This will virtually guarantee we do not have ANY ISSUES with the West End Jetty. Additions: the Escape the Cape Open Water Classic and Dolphin Escape 1 Miler is set to precede the triathlon on SATURDAY, June 9th. Check delmosports.com for details.
Atlantic City Triathlon: The race was AWESOME in 2017. Extending both the bike and run to keep more in line with Olympic distance racing was a huge bonus and the finish in front of Boardwalk Hall truly made this the "Ultimate Training Race" for IM 70.3 AC. HOWEVER, the shuttle busses STUNK. We realized through trial and error there is no effective way to get busses to/from Bader to Boardwalk Hall during the height of the event. Additions: the northern end of the boardwalk construction is scheduled to be completed in 2018, stay tuned for an altered course that virtually eliminates any additional running on Bader Field.

IRONMAN 70.3 Atlantic City: I loved the second running of IMAC 70.3, but if I could go back I would have added more shade tents for our athletes at the pre-race meetings and better control of our swim staging area. Additions for 2018: IMAC 70.3 will have camping in 2018. IMAC 70.3 will be the Wildflower of 70.3 racing... ALSO, as we mentioned for TRI AC, the northern section of the Atlantic City Boardwalk is set to be complete, this will eliminate almost ALL extra mileage on Bader Field and lead to a better run course with added ocean views and breezes!
